What it is

Technographics is data about the technology a company runs: its CRM and ATS, cloud provider (AWS, GCP, Azure), programming languages and frameworks, data platform, and the rest of its dev and marketing stack. Where firmographics describes a company by industry, headcount, funding stage and geography, technographics describes it by tooling. For a consultant working a tech-adjacent desk, the stack matters almost as much as the org chart, because it points at which specialists a company will need next.

The data comes from a company's public footprint: GitHub repository activity, job description language, engineering blog posts, vendor case studies, and technology signatures visible on the company website. How rich the profile gets depends on how visible that footprint is. A company with an active GitHub and a maintained engineering blog yields far more than a quiet one, and the strongest profiles combine several sources rather than relying on any single one.

A stack change is a hiring need that has not been advertised yet.

Why it matters

Technographics does two jobs. As a filter, it narrows your ICP to companies running technology relevant to your specialism, a desk that places cloud infrastructure engineers only wants accounts with an AWS- or GCP-heavy stack, not every company in a headcount band. As a signal, it flags the moment that stack changes, because a move to Kubernetes or a new data platform usually means a company will need specialists to run it, often before the role is ever advertised. The two uses reinforce each other: the tighter the stack filter, the more precisely a change in that stack can be trusted as a real signal rather than background noise.

Without technographics a consultant either casts too wide, reaching accounts whose stack has nothing to do with their specialism, or waits for the job post and finds a competitor already in. Technographics closes that gap on both ends: tighter targeting up front, and an earlier window to act when the stack moves.

What is the difference between technographics and firmographics?

Firmographics describes a company by industry, headcount, funding stage and geography, the shape of the business. Technographics describes it by the technology it runs: CRM, ATS, cloud provider, languages and data platform. Most ICPs combine both. Firmographics narrows the market, technographics adds precision inside it.

Where does technographic data come from?

It is compiled from a company's public footprint: GitHub repository activity, job description language, engineering blog posts, vendor case studies and technology signatures on the company website. Coverage varies with how visible a company's engineering work is, an active GitHub presence yields a far richer profile than a quiet one.

Can I use technographics to filter accounts, not just detect signals?

Yes. You can set stack requirements directly in your ICP, for example only companies running a specific cloud platform or data stack, so accounts outside your specialism never reach your task inbox in the first place.

Is a tech migration always a hiring signal?

Not immediately, but it usually leads to one. A company adopting a new stack typically hires a specialist to lead the change before scaling the team behind them, so the migration is an earlier, quieter signal that a role is coming.
